Identifying Transformative Technological Advances and Sustainability-Driven Trends Shaping Industrial Weighing Instruments
The industrial weighing market is undergoing a paradigm shift fueled by advancements in sensor technology, connectivity, and data analytics. Emerging innovations in load cell design and electronic circuitry now deliver unprecedented levels of accuracy, temperature compensation, and resilience against mechanical stress. Concurrently, the proliferation of smart displays with touch interfaces and wireless communication capabilities is transforming how operators interact with weighing systems and downstream control networks.In parallel, sustainability considerations are driving the adoption of energy-efficient designs and materials that reduce the environmental footprint of weighing equipment. Manufacturers are exploring eco-friendly alloys and modular assembly techniques that extend product lifecycles and simplify maintenance procedures. Additionally, the integration of predictive maintenance algorithms leverages IoT data streams to foresee potential failures, enabling service providers to optimize spare-parts logistics and minimize unplanned downtime.
Furthermore, regulatory developments around trade metrology and safety standards have spurred the implementation of advanced verification processes. Digital signatures, audit trails, and tamper-proof hardware modules ensure compliance with global and regional requirements, bolstering confidence in measurement integrity. Taken together, these transformative shifts are setting the stage for a new generation of weighing solutions that balance precision, intelligence, and sustainability.
Assessing the Far-Reaching Effects of Recent United States Tariff Implementations on Industrial Weighing Solutions and Supply Chain Dynamics
In 2025, United States tariff adjustments introduced a series of new duties on imported weighing instrument components, leading to notable shifts in supply chain strategies and cost structures. Equipment manufacturers have responded by evaluating alternative sourcing locations and renegotiating supplier contracts to mitigate increased material expenses. These measures have prompted a reevaluation of just-in-time inventory practices in favor of nearshoring initiatives that reduce exposure to tariff volatility.As a consequence, some international producers have established assembly operations within duty-exempt zones, leveraging local incentives to maintain price competitiveness. Domestic producers, in turn, have capitalized on these adjustments to reinforce market share, investing in capacity expansions and workforce training to meet growing demand for locally manufactured solutions. At the same time, end users have exhibited heightened sensitivity to total landed cost, prompting service providers to offer bundled maintenance and calibration programs that spread tariff-related expenses across the equipment lifecycle.
Transitioning from reactively adjusting to duties, leading organizations are now adopting proactive trade-compliance frameworks. By forecasting potential regulatory shifts and engaging in multilateral consultations, they enhance their resilience against future tariff disruptions. Collectively, these strategic responses underscore how the 2025 tariff landscape has reshaped competitive dynamics, supply chain structures, and pricing models within the industrial weighing scale instrument market.

Revealing Regional Dynamics and Diverse Growth Drivers Across the Americas Europe Middle East and Africa and Asia Pacific
Regional dynamics within the industrial weighing scale instrument landscape vary significantly across the Americas, Europe Middle East and Africa, and Asia Pacific. In the Americas, the convergence of advanced manufacturing hubs and extensive logistics networks drives demand for integrated weighing solutions that support high throughput and regulatory compliance. The presence of large agricultural and food processing operations further accentuates the need for rugged scales capable of withstanding harsh environments.Within Europe Middle East and Africa, stringent trade metrology regulations and a growing emphasis on traceability are accelerating the uptake of digital weighing instruments with built-in audit capabilities. Regulatory frameworks in key European nations mandate regular calibration and verification, thereby creating a robust service ecosystem around weighing equipment maintenance. Concurrently, infrastructural investments in emerging Middle Eastern markets are spurring interest in heavy-duty scales for mining and metal extraction applications.
Asia Pacific continues to be a hotbed of manufacturing expansion, leading to high demand for cost-effective weighing solutions across electronic, mechanical and hydraulic technologies. Rapid urbanization and the evolution of pharmaceutical and food and beverage processing facilities in this region underscore the importance of scalable display technologies and remote monitoring capabilities. Collectively, these regional insights illuminate the diverse drivers shaping product preferences, service models and regulatory compliance strategies across global markets.
